17 Assam Districts Flooded; No Ferry Services As Rivers Above Danger Mark

17 Assam Districts Flooded; No Ferry Services As Rivers Above Danger Mark A monsoon flood in Assam has inundated at least 17 districts in the north-east state and affected over four lakh people, officials said. The Brahmaputra river - one of the largest rivers in the world that cuts through Assam's biggest city Guwahati - and five other rivers are flowing above the danger mark, officials said.
